JeuWeb - Crée ton jeu par navigateur
[pas réglé...] Mon CSS sous ie ? - Version imprimable

+- JeuWeb - Crée ton jeu par navigateur (https://jeuweb.org)
+-- Forum : Discussions, Aide, Ressources... (https://jeuweb.org/forumdisplay.php?fid=38)
+--- Forum : Programmation, infrastructure (https://jeuweb.org/forumdisplay.php?fid=51)
+--- Sujet : [pas réglé...] Mon CSS sous ie ? (/showthread.php?tid=835)



[pas réglé...] Mon CSS sous ie ? - Raoull - 20-02-2007

J'ai réalisé 2 templates en css, presque similaires, pour des sites dont je m'occupe, qui passe parfaitement sous opera et firefox.

Par contre, je ne peux pas tester sous IE...
Sans vous raconter les détails de mes mésaventures, je tourne sous win98 avec IE4 (impossible d'installer IE6), qui ne gère pas du tout le CSS, donc impossible de voir ce que ca donne sous IE !

J'aimerai juste que qlqu'un regarde ce que donne les pages d'accueil de ces 2 sites, d'abord avec opera ou firefox, puis avec IE6 et/ou IE7 pour comparer et me dise si ca passe nikel. Ou mieux, me fasse un ptit screenshot si ya un blem.

Voila, c'est plutot inhabituel, mais ca me dépannerait vraiment !

Les pages sont :
http://xparangon.free.fr/index.php
et
http://isoat.free.fr/index.php

merci d'avance !


RE: Mon CSS sous ie ? - orditeck - 20-02-2007

Comme on peut constater tu sais t'y prendre Smile
Quand un design est bien, il passe #1 sous FireFox et sous IE7.

Donc voilà, les deux passe #1 sous IE7 et sous FireFox.
IE6 aucune idée, je suis sous Vista.

Mais bon, maintenant la MAJ de IE6 vers IE7 est proposé avec Windows XP.

[Edit :]
Screen :
[Image: sanstitreuq6.th.png]


RE: Mon CSS sous ie ? - Raoull - 20-02-2007

Super !

Pas d'image de l'autre site, pourtant j'ai très peur de savoir si IE aligne correctement le float avec les "boutons" sur la droite...

Mais tu n'as rien dit, c'est donc que ca passe bien aussi, suis content Smile

Merci Orditeck !


RE: [réglé] Mon CSS sous ie ? - Sephi-Chan - 20-02-2007

Voila un screenshot du site Isoat :
[Image: raoullpw8.th.jpg]

Les flottants de droite ne sont pas des block sur IE. oO?


RE: [réglé] Mon CSS sous ie ? - Raoull - 20-02-2007

ha merci !

Je m'en doutais, les float merdent toujours un peu généralement sous ie, mais là ca a l'air pas trop méchant.

A première vue, le DIV des boutons de droite ne garde pas les propriétés du DIV parent (boutons de gauche) et donc le border-top et le padding n'apparaissent pas. Suffirait donc de les rajouter dans la déclaration de ce DIV, même si ca fait double emploi pour les autres navigateurs...


RE: [réglé] Mon CSS sous ie ? - Sephi-Chan - 20-02-2007

Les floats, moins je m'en sers, mieux je me porte !

Smile


RE: [réglé] Mon CSS sous ie ? - Raoull - 20-02-2007

Ca y est ca devrait être corrigé.

Le probleme avec ce float à droite, c'est que si j'ai trop de boutons à gauche, et qu'un visiteur a une fenêtre pas assez large, les "boutons" de gauche vont passer sur 2 lignes et se chevaucher.
Line-height devrait régler ca, mais ca donne pas grand chose...

C'est pourtant bien pratique les float, pour mettre un menu à gauche ou à droite en css, par exemple. Et ca n'a rien de sorcier Wink

Ce qui est plus aléatoire, enfin je crois, c'est les position absolute. J'avais pas trop testé, et la j'ai fait une 2eme version du style de isoat (normal2) où les boutons de doite se retrouve au dessus de la ligne (pour parer ce probleme de chevauchement).
Calculé au pixel près, ca passe bien sous firefox et opera pour l'instant.


RE: [réglé] Mon CSS sous ie ? - Sephi-Chan - 20-02-2007

Hm.. C'est toujours pareil sur le site. Le problème est le même.

Si tu veux modifier en live, viens sur IRC comme ça je peux tester des que tu fais une modif' Wink.


RE: [réglé] Mon CSS sous ie ? - Raoull - 21-02-2007

Merci mais c bon, j'ai installé IE6, et j'ai donc modifié mon css pour ie, pas mal alourdi d'ailleurs, obligé de passer par 3 div au leiu de 2.

Ca passe donc toujours aussi bien sous FF et opera, mais j'ai encore un souci avec isoat sous IE6...

Le "border-bottom: 1px solid #444444;" ne passe pas du tout pour les boutons à droite (préférences, inscription, connexion)... C'est très bizarre... je comprends vraiement pas où est le probleme...

Voila mon css pour les 3 duvs (menu, menu_gauche, menu_droit) :

Code :
#menu {
    margin: 0;
    padding: 0;
    font-weight: bold;
}

#menu_gauche {
    margin: 0;
    padding: 0;
    padding: 5px 0 5px 0;
}
#menu_gauche a {
    margin: 0;
    padding: 5px 8px;
    background-color: #EFEFEF;
    color: #444444;
    border-right: 1px solid #444444;
    border-bottom: #444444 1px solid;
    text-decoration: none;
}
#menu_gauche a:hover{
    margin: 0;
    padding: 5px 8px;
    background-color: #FFFFFF;
    color: #000000;
    border-color: #000;
    text-decoration: none;
}

#menu_droit {
    float: right;
    margin: 0;
    padding: 0;
    padding: 5px 0;
}
#menu_droit a {
    margin: 0;
    padding: 5px 8px;
    background-color: #EFEFEF;
    color: #444444;
    border-left: 1px solid #444444;
    border-bottom: 1px solid #444444; /* <--- ca ne passe pas sous ie */
    text-decoration: none;
}
#menu_droit a:hover{
    margin: 0;
    padding: 5px 8px;
    background-color: #FFFFFF;
    color: #000000;
    border-color: #000;
    text-decoration: none;
}